As far as I've read '88 was the only year for your color.It's called medium orange metallic(code 63/WA 9188).It was available on all models.According to the "Camaro Whitebook" there were 3010 total Camaros ordered in that color for '88.So to me it is an uncommon color for an IROC and looks nice too.It would be worth keeping her that color IMHO.

You are most welcome,also the color code should be in the last line of your SPID in the console(but make sure the VIN matches your car if you haven't already).

I love mine and wouldn't part with her.I wanted one when they were new but ended up buying a Daytona TurboZ in '84(long story).Mine runs well and Ive upgraded the ignition and wires as she has 150K miles(although the original paint and interior doesn't show it).She still has the functional composite hood(and the other thread about lightweight parts I checked and she has the aluminum bumper bar).Yes there are members of the Crossfire vault running thier '82 & '84 Vettes in the 12's.
I bought another intake over a year ago with plans to port it as per the instructions from the Crossfire vault and a couple other sources(doing it to another one at least if i screw it up).I have an extra set of TBI's to have rebushed and eventually ported to 2".I had bought L69 exhaust manifolds first from another member then found L98 with the AIR tubes and y-pipe to replace the exhaust manifolds & y-pipe the LU5 shares with the LG4(not to mention the N10 dual mufflers).But now I have another deal to get Edlebrock TES HO headers from another member.I already have a 3" catco cat and then all I'll need exhaust wise is the catback.And the other thing is to upgrade to the '85 TPI fuel pump and lines.
They do take extra work but they can be fun.Finding one that hasn't been converted or motor swapped is getting hard.Mine is still numbers matching which may mean something someday.

GM didn't break the option combos down like that.But needless to say a '88 code63/WA 9188 IROC with B2L/L98 with CC1 T-tops would be very uncommon.I was wondering what color stripe/decal came with the color.Do you know if the original wheels had the gold inserts?both of you have nice looking cars.
